For instance

UK//fɔːr ˈɪn.stəns//US//fɔr ˈɪn.stəns//

Meaning of For instance

Used to introduce a specific example.

In simple words: For example

For instance in a sentence

  • You can learn a lot from books, for instance, history books.
  • Many fruits are rich in vitamins; for instance, oranges are high in vitamin C.
  • Some countries have unique customs; for instance, Japan has the tea ceremony.
  • Many activities are relaxing; for instance, yoga helps reduce stress.
  • There are various programming languages; for instance, Python is quite popular.

How to use For instance

Use 'for instance' to introduce examples in writing or speech. It's versatile but may sound more formal than 'for example'. Avoid using it in casual texts.

Common mistakes with For instance

  • 'For instance' is often confused with 'for example', but both are acceptable.
  • Learners sometimes omit commas before or after 'for instance'.
  • Use with complete sentences; avoid fragments.
